5#include <weave/provider/test/fake_task_runner.h>
6
7namespace weave {
8namespace provider {
9namespace test {
10
11class FakeTaskRunner::TestClock : public base::Clock {
12 public:
13  base::Time Now() override { return now_; }
14
15  void SetNow(base::Time now) { now_ = now; }
16
17 private:
18  base::Time now_{base::Time::Now()};
19};
20
21FakeTaskRunner::FakeTaskRunner() : test_clock_{new TestClock} {}
22
23FakeTaskRunner::~FakeTaskRunner() {}
24
25bool FakeTaskRunner::RunOnce() {
26  if (queue_.empty())
27    return false;
28  auto top = queue_.top();
29  queue_.pop();
30  test_clock_->SetNow(std::max(test_clock_->Now(), top.first.first));
31  top.second.Run();
32  return true;
33}
34
35void FakeTaskRunner::Run(size_t number_of_iterations) {
36  break_ = false;
37  for (size_t i = 0; i < number_of_iterations && !break_ && RunOnce(); ++i) {
38  }
39}
40
41void FakeTaskRunner::Break() {
42  break_ = true;
43}
44
45base::Clock* FakeTaskRunner::GetClock() {
46  return test_clock_.get();
47}
48
49void FakeTaskRunner::PostDelayedTask(const tracked_objects::Location& from_here,
50                                     const base::Closure& task,
51                                     base::TimeDelta delay) {
52  queue_.emplace(std::make_pair(test_clock_->Now() + delay, ++counter_), task);
53}
54
55size_t FakeTaskRunner::GetTaskQueueSize() const {
56  return queue_.size();
57}
58
59}  // namespace test
60}  // namespace provider
61}  // namespace weave
